True Wireless Stereo (TWS) earbuds are evolving faster than ever in 2025. With brands constantly pushing boundaries in sound quality, battery life, and smart features, this year is shaping up to be a turning point in wireless audio.

AI-Powered Sound Personalization

Leading brands like Sony, Apple, and Samsung are introducing AI-based adaptive sound profiles that automatically adjust EQ settings in real-time based on your environment, ear shape, and listening habits.

🔹 Example: Apple AirPods Pro 3 (2025) is rumored to come with machine learning-based audio adaptation and voice optimization for FaceTime and calls.

Built-In Health Sensors

The line between wearables and audio gear is blurring. Expect new TWS earbuds in 2025 to include heart rate monitoring, body temperature sensors, and even blood oxygen tracking.

🔹 Example: Samsung Galaxy Buds 3 Pro may integrate Samsung BioActive Sensor—the same tech found in Galaxy Watches.

Advanced ANC with Transparency Boost

2025 models are set to bring next-gen Active Noise Cancellation (ANC) that not only blocks unwanted sounds but can also highlight important noises like alarms, traffic, or conversations.

🔹 Example: Bose QuietComfort Ultra Buds 2 (2025) will reportedly offer dynamic environmental recognition for switching modes automatically.

Real-Time Translation

Google and a few AI startups are working on in-ear real-time translation powered by AI. This would be a game-changer for travelers and global professionals.

🔹 Example: The upcoming Pixel Buds 3 Pro might allow real-time two-way language translation without needing a phone screen.

Extended Battery Life + Solar Charging

Battery life is no longer limited to 5–6 hours. The newest TWS earbuds in 2025 aim to provide up to 15 hours of continuous playback, with solar or wireless charging cases for on-the-go recharging.

🔹 Example: Jabra Elite 10 Active is rumored to support solar-powered case charging and fast charge tech offering 2 hours of playback in just 5 minutes.

Lossless Audio and Hi-Fi Streaming Support

With services like Apple Music and Tidal offering lossless formats, new TWS earbuds are getting support for ALAC, FLAC, and LDAC codecs, giving audiophiles a reason to smile.

🔹 Example: Sony WF-1000XM6 will likely support 24-bit Hi-Res Audio Wireless with LDAC 2.0.

Multi-Device AI Switching

Forget manual pairing. 2025 earbuds will feature smart multi-device pairing powered by AI that knows which device you’re actively using — your phone, laptop, or tablet — and switches automatically.

🔹 Example: Nothing Ear (3) is expected to bring a “context-aware” pairing engine that syncs with your ecosystem instantly.

Spatial Audio and Head Tracking

Enhanced spatial audio with dynamic head tracking is becoming a standard, bringing a cinema-like experience for games, VR, and immersive music.

🔹 Example: Beats Fit Pro 2 (2025) is tipped to bring 360-degree Dolby Atmos spatial audio with real-time head movement detection.

Touchless Control with Gestures or Voice

Say goodbye to tapping your earbuds. New models allow gesture-based control (like nodding to accept a call) or voice assistants that are always listening, even without a phone.

🔹 Example: Huawei FreeBuds 6i could support AI motion tracking gestures and offline voice control.

10. Secure Fit and Custom Molds via Ap

TWS earbuds in 2025 will focus on comfort too. Using ear scanning via smartphone apps, some brands will offer custom-mold fit for better audio isolation and secure grip.

🔹 Example: Anker Soundcore Liberty Pro 5 might use 3D ear-mapping via mobile app to deliver tailored in-ear fit options.

1. Apple AirPods Pro

  • Expected Launch: Late 2025
  • Highlights: Adaptive audio, lossless streaming via Apple Vision Pro, improved ANC
  • Why It’s Exciting: Rumors suggest new health-tracking sensors and better integration with iOS 19. Apple might finally introduce USB-C charging across all variants.

2. Samsung Galaxy Buds 3 Pro

  • Expected Launch: Q3 2025 (alongside Galaxy Z Fold 7)
  • Highlights: Intelligent ANC, ultra-wideband for precise location, improved 360 Audio
  • Why It’s Exciting: A more compact design with upgraded dual drivers for deeper bass and cleaner treble.

3. Nothing Ear (3)

  • Expected Launch: Mid 2025
  • Highlights: Personalized sound profiles, improved transparency mode, LDAC codec support
  • Why It’s Exciting: Known for design and sound, Nothing might bring gesture-based controls and a more open design this time.

4. Sony WF-1000XM6

  • Expected Launch: Q4 2025
  • Highlights: Industry-leading ANC, AI-based ambient sound, spatial audio
  • Why It’s Exciting: Sony sets benchmarks in audio. This iteration might include Bluetooth LE Audio and Auracast.

5. OnePlus Buds Pro 3

  • Expected Launch: September 2025
  • Highlights: Dolby Atmos, dynamic bass boost, ultra-low latency mode
  • Why It’s Exciting: Aimed at gamers and movie watchers with a budget, these could offer great sound without breaking the bank.
